Add {format} for webp support
This commit is contained in:
parent
30d18dfbb2
commit
49bde9b5d1
|
@ -63,7 +63,7 @@ define(['map/clientlayer', 'map/labellayer', 'map/button', 'leaflet', 'map/activ
|
||||||
var layers = config.mapLayers.map(function (d) {
|
var layers = config.mapLayers.map(function (d) {
|
||||||
return {
|
return {
|
||||||
'name': d.name,
|
'name': d.name,
|
||||||
'layer': L.tileLayer(d.url, d.config)
|
'layer': L.tileLayer(d.url.replace('{format}', document.createElement('canvas').toDataURL('image/webp').indexOf('data:image/webp') === 0 ? 'webp' : 'png'), d.config)
|
||||||
};
|
};
|
||||||
});
|
});
|
||||||
|
|
||||||
|
|
Reference in New Issue